JOB TITLE: Community Outreach Coordinator II JOB PURPOSE: Plans, coordinates, and delivers in person and remote functional behavioral assessments to support the state implementation of the Home and Community Based Supports (HCBS) Waiver system. This includes travelling throughout the state to collect the Inventory for Client and Agency Planning (ICAP), or similar functional assessments, in client homes or other community settings. REMOTE WORK ELIGIBILITY: This position can be based in any part of Wyoming, but the candidate must be able to travel to conduct ICAPs, as well as make occasional trips to Laramie, WY for departmental activities.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: Education: Bachelor's degree in disabilities studies, human/child development, psychology, social work, public health or other fields related to disabilities or human services. Experience: 2 years progressively responsible work-related experience. Experience must include at least 2 years at the preceding level or equivalent. Experience with clinical interviewing, standardized assessments, or other objective measures of human development and/or behavior. Required licensure, certification, registration, or other requirements: Valid driver's license with no major infractions or other limitations that could limit driving a fleet vehicle.
